What the process industry is worth
Jan 29 2008 by Sue Scott, Evening Gazette
THE process industry accounts for more than 60% of the Teesside economy.
Almost 25% of the North-east’s £35bn GDP is generated by the process sector.
35% of the UK’s pharmaceutical GDP is produced in the North-east.
58% of the UK’s petrochemical industry is based in the North-east.
70% of Teesport trade is in goods from the process sector.
More than 500 companies are engaged in the process industries across the North-east, employing 34,000 people directly and impacting indirectly on the incomes of a further 280,000.
92% of UK chemicals were exported in 2004, 61% to the EU.
Chemicals account for 11% of the value added by all UK manufacturing.
The process industry is the top manufacturing earner, contributing a surplus approaching £6bn.
The industry spends nearly £2bn annually on new capital investment.
